On the 7th March 2025 Companions of the Royal Arch were treated to an excellent and informative demonstration of the Ceremony of Veils, a historic ceremony that once formed an integral part of a Freemasons’ Masonic experience.

Today in England the ceremony is solely authorised for use in Chapters in Bristol but it is still very much part of the Royal Arch system in Ireland, the United States of America and in Scotland.

Over 80 Companions attended the presentation at The Franklin Rooms in Gillingham which was followed by an enjoyable festive board. The Deputy Provincial Grand Superintendent E Comp John Kennett Baker attended as well as Past Grand Superintendent Geoffrey Gordon Dearing.

A booklet to accompany the presentation was presented to the Companions.
